Best Myrtle Beach Public Preschools (2026)

For the 2026 school year, there are 10 public preschools serving 9,281 students in Myrtle Beach, SC.
The top-ranked public preschools in Myrtle Beach, SC are Ocean Bay Elementary School, St. James Elementary School and Forestbrook Elementary School. Overall testing rank is based on a school's combined math and reading proficiency test score ranking.
Myrtle Beach, SC public preschools have an average math proficiency score of 63% (versus the South Carolina public pre school average of 48%), and reading proficiency score of 63% (versus the 48% statewide average). Pre schools in Myrtle Beach have an average ranking of 10/10, which is in the top 10% of South Carolina public pre schools.
Minority enrollment is 44%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is less than the South Carolina public preschool average of 55% (majority Black).
